Church of the Pilgrims / Our Lady of Lebanon Maronite Cathedral
Henry & Remsen
New York City: Brooklyn, NY
Consoles
Main
- Organ type: Traditional With Roll Top
- Console position: Console in Fixed Position, Center
- 3 manuals
- 46 registers
- Key action Type: Tubular Pneumatic (Pressure)
- Stop action Type: Tubular Pneumatic (Details Unknown)
- Stop layout Type: Stop Keys Above Top Manual
- Pedal Type: Concave Radiating (Meeting AGO Standards)
- Expression Type: Balanced Expression Shoes/Pedals (Meeting AGO Standards)
- Has crescendo
- Combination action: Adjustable Combination Pistons
- Has combination thumb pistons
- Has tutti toe pistons
Notes
2005-03-01 - Identified from company publications as edited and expanded in <i>The Hook Opus List 1829-1935</i>, ed. William T. Van Pelt (Organ Historical Society, 1991). -Database Manager
2006-09-21 - Renovated by Hook in 1877 according to <i>The Brooklyn Eagle</i>, Nov. 4, 1877. -Database Manager
2007-02-14 - Updated through on-line information from Very Rev. Francis J. Marini. -- Installation in front left in gallery above altar (original location). -Database Manager
